Director of Pharmacy Resume Example

Resume Score: 80%

Love this resume?Build Your Own Now
DIRECTOR OF PHARMACY
Professional Summary

Pharmacy leader with over 18 years of successful experiences in community, nuclear, and hospital pharmacies, as well as, pharmaceutical drug distribution. Recognized consistently for performance excellence and contributions to success in varying pharmacy settings through leadership and process operations.

Education
PharmD: Pharmacy, 05/2002
Drake University - Des Moines, IA
MBA: Business Administration, 05/2002
Drake University - Des Moines, IA
ChemistryFlorida Agricultural And Mechanical University - Tallahassee, FL

Attended 1995-1998.

Associate of Arts: General Studies, 05/1995
Manatee Community College - Bradenton, FL
Skills
  • 16 years - Pharmacy Management
  • Quality Assurance and Control
  • Drug Inventory Management
  • Customer Service, Education, and Counseling
  • Drug Utilization Review
  • FDA Drug Safety Guidelines
  • FDA and USP Guidelines
  • Drug Formulation and Compounding
  • Verifying Orders
StrengthsFinder 2.0 Results
  • Futuristic
  • Responsibility
  • Learner
  • Input
  • Individualization
Work History
Director of Pharmacy, 09/2018 to Current
LeeSar Inc. – Sarasota, FL

Direct Reports: 2 Pharmacists, 8 Technicians, 2 Drivers

  • Complete build of this service line from after conception to full implementation.
  • Designed daily workflow processes for efficiency and safety.
  • Developed policies and procedures for effective pharmacy management.
  • Recruited, hired and trained all staff, providing direct supervision, ongoing staff development and continuing education to employees.
  • Direct day-to-day administrative and operational functions for pharmacy replenishment, providing guidance and leadership to employees.
  • Generated and reviewed incident reports, actualizing appropriate corrective action plans to mitigate ongoing and potential situations.
  • Produced monthly reports, including invoices, operating expenses and monthly sale summaries statements for financial accountabilities.
  • Oversaw all financial transactions and management functions, strategically managing $1M operating budget.
  • Ordered all pharmacy supplies and kept check on inventory level to ensure 11 turns per year.
Pharmacy Operations Manager, 10/2010 to 09/2018
Sarasota Memorial Health Care System – Sarasota, FL

Staff Pharmacist: October 2010- August 2011

IV Room Team Leader (promotion) : August 2011 - December 2016

Manager of Drug Distribution (promotion): December 2016 - September 2018

Direct reports: 5 Pharmacists, 15 Technicians

  • 2011-2018 Main Sterile Compounding Room Compliance: Worked vigorously with Plant Operations and contract vendors to bring this compounding room into regulatory compliance through series of small incremental changes. Successfully redesigned the room which was implemented after my leave and is currently operational.
  • 2011-2013 Large Volume Infusion Pump Project (Baxter SIgma Spectrum): This was a house-wide implementation. Successfully built the entire drug library. Worked with interdisciplinary teams (Biomed, Environmental Service, Clinical Support) to operationalize the launch of the pumps. Worked with Nurse Educators and individual nursing work groups to identify nursing needs and requests for successful day-to-day use. This work continued for maintenance needs, additional needs or requests for deletions/changes.
  • 2013-2014 Opening of NICU Sterile Compounding Room: Worked with Plant Operations and construction vendors in order to bring room into compliance with regulations. Facilitated total parenteral contract update in order to implement compounding for the NICU population segregated for safety.
  • 2015-2017 Sterile Compounding Workflow Platform (DoseEdge): Vetted, contracted, built, trained and implemented this workflow platform that allowed for sterile compound to be standardized and documented for better patient safety. This also allowed for remote verification of preparations which improved throughput for compounding production.
  • 2015-2017 Opening of OR Pharmacy with Sterile Compounding Room: Worked with OR Pharmacy Specialist, Plant Operations, Architect and constructions vendors from vetting to successful opening. This expansion project facilitated better pharmacy services to meet OR needs.
  • 2017 NICU Syringe Pump Project: Successfully built the entire drug library. Worked with interdisciplinary teams (Biomed, Environmental Service, Clinical Support) to operationalize the launch of the pumps. Worked with individual nursing work groups to identify nursing needs and requests for successful day-to-day use. Trained the NICU Pharmacist to maintain the continued operations after launch.
  • 2017-2018 Pharmacy Inventory Workflow Platform (Pyxis Logistics): Vetted, assisted in the build and implementation of this inventory software project.
  • 2017-2018 Cancer Center Pharmacy and Sterile Compounding Room. Participated in multiple vetting meetings to design the Pharmacy and Sterile Compounding Room to meet the needs of use.

Other accomplishments:

  • Resident projects
  • USP 800 Compliance Project
  • Author of multiple policies
  • Publication: Houchard, Gary, Lewis, Pam, Hymel, Lisa, Prenosil, Sandra, and Kisgen, Rebecca "A Comprehensive Approach to USP 800 Compliance", Pharmacy Purchasing & Products, November 2017, pp 20-31

Other responsibilities:

  • Implemented policies and standard operating procedures for continuous quality improvement.
  • Conducted performance reviews, offering praise and recommendations for improvement.
  • Evaluated upcoming projects and forecast expected resource needed to improve pharmacy workflow or increase patient safety .
  • Developed and implemented daily operations plans to improve staff efficiency and provide safe medication distribution.
  • Supervised all sterile compounding activities within four sterile compounding areas.
Nuclear Pharmacist, 03/2006 to 09/2010
Cardinal Health – Lakewood Ranch, FL

Staff Pharmacist: 2006-2009

Radiation Safety Officer (promotion): 2009-2010

Supervised: 3 Technicians, 5 Drivers

  • 2006 March-May- Nuclear Pharmacist Course successfully completed
  • 2006 June Radiation Safety Training successfully completed
  • 2006-September Nuclear Pharmacist License obtained

Responsibilities

  • Compounded sterile radiopharmaceuticals for hospitals and imaging centers.
  • Ensured operations and documentation were compliant with regulatory agencies.
  • Served as primary point of contact for regulatory agencies when on-site.
  • Received phone order and data entry for preparing doses for next day.
  • Managed couriers to ensure timely delivery of medications.
Pharmacy Manager, 06/2002 to 06/2009
Walgreens – Bradenton, FL

Staff Pharmacist: 2002-2004

Pharmacy Manager (promotion): 2004-2006

Part-time status: 2006-2009 and 2011-2013

Direct Reports: 4 Pharmacists, 8 Technicians

  • Compared prescription details against safety standards and insurance requirements to support patients.
  • Recommended OTC devices or medication options to help mitigate individual symptoms.
  • Educated patients on possible drug interactions, potential side effects and optimal methods of administration.
  • Collaborated with store manager to maintain daily operations.
  • Implemented procedures necessary for compounding, mixing, packaging and labeling.
  • Evaluated patient histories to assess medication compliance and spot issues such as doctor shopping or excessive usage.
  • Trained pharmacy interns and newly hired pharmacy technicians.
  • Vaccinated patients to provide immunity against influenza, pneumonia and other diseases.
  • Protected drug inventories from damage or theft by establishing and enforcing clear pharmacy policies.

Other accomplishments:

2005 Successfully relocated the pharmacy from existing location to a new location.

Affiliations
  • ASHP (2011-present)
  • FSHP (2011-present)
Additional Information

Pharmacist License: PS37145, active/clear (2002-present)

Consultant Pharmacist License: PU8434, active/clear (2019-present)

Nuclear Pharmacist License: NP364, inactive (2006-2010)
